About Jacob Bobonis

Jacob Bobonis is a scholar working on Genetics, Molecular Biology, Ecology, Public Health, Environmental and Occupational Health and Endocrinology, having authored 8 papers that have together received 667 indexed citations. Recurring topics across this work include Bacterial Genetics and Biotechnology (6 papers), RNA and protein synthesis mechanisms (4 papers), Protein Structure and Dynamics (2 papers), Bacteriophages and microbial interactions (2 papers), Genomics and Phylogenetic Studies (1 paper), Evolution and Genetic Dynamics (1 paper), Insect symbiosis and bacterial influences (1 paper) and Plant nutrient uptake and metabolism (1 paper). The work is most often cited by research in Molecular Medicine (116 citations), Microbiology (55 citations), Applied Microbiology and Biotechnology (16 citations), Endocrinology (38 citations) and Molecular Biology (367 citations). Jacob Bobonis has collaborated with scholars based in Germany, United Kingdom and Switzerland. Frequent co-authors include Athanasios Typas, André Mateus, Mikhail M. Savitski, Frank Stein, Nils Kurzawa, Johannes F. Hevler, Dominic Helm, Joel Selkrig, Matylda Zietek and Manuel Banzhaf. Their work appears in journals such as Nature, Molecular Systems Biology, Nature Protocols, mSystems and Molecular Microbiology.
